Mastering AI Efficiency: Proven Prompt Management Techniques

Initiation Strategies with Stakeholders

Engaging stakeholders in discussions about AI and prompt management requires a strategic approach. Effective communication is key to aligning expectations and achieving successful outcomes.

Structuring Prompts Effectively

The way a prompt is structured can greatly influence the quality and relevance of the responses generated by AI models. Here are essential guidelines for structuring effective prompts:

  1. Context/Background: Provide necessary context to ensure the AI understands the scenario or problem fully.
  2. Instructions: Clearly outline what is required from the AI. Specific instructions help in achieving precise results.
  3. Input Data: Supply any essential data that the AI needs to operate on.
  4. Output Indicator: Specify what form the output should take. For example, whether it should be a list, a summary, or a detailed explanation.

A well-crafted prompt typically includes these components to guide the AI in generating relevant and accurate responses.

Table of Prompt Components

Component Description
Context Background information for the scenario
Instructions Specific guidelines for what is required
Input Data Essential data for the AI to process
Output Indicator Specification of the form of the desired output

For those interested in the mechanics, see our detailed guide on ai prompt engineering.

Utilizing Reflective Probing

Reflective probing is another crucial aspect of engaging stakeholders. This method involves asking thoughtful and reflective questions to gain deeper insights and foster meaningful dialogue. Here’s how to use reflective probing effectively:

  1. Empathetic Language and Humility: Use language that conveys understanding and respect for the stakeholders’ perspectives. Show humility in acknowledging their expertise and viewpoints.
  2. Humor and Emotions: Leveraging humor and emotions can break the ice and make discussions more relatable and engaging.
  3. Acknowledge Challenges: Recognize and address key challenges faced by stakeholders to show that their concerns are being heard and validated.
  4. Active Listening: Be an attentive listener to ensure stakeholders feel valued and understood.

Engaging stakeholders using these strategies can lead to more productive conversations and better outcomes when managing prompts for prompt-based AI applications.

Incorporating these techniques into your prompt management practices can result in more effective and efficient use of AI models, ultimately enhancing the quality of interactions and results. For more on optimizing prompt usage, see our resources on ai prompt feedback and ai prompt evaluation.

Effective Prompt Crafting for LLMs

Crafting prompts for large language models (LLMs) is an art that combines clarity, specificity, and context to get the desired output. This section discusses how to effectively balance these elements and the key components that make up a well-crafted prompt.

Balancing Clarity and Specificity

Prompts for LLMs, which are statistical in nature, can significantly impact model output. Even subtle changes in wording can dramatically affect the quality and relevance of the response. Achieving a balance between clarity and specificity is essential:

  • Clarity: Clear prompts eliminate ambiguity, ensuring that the LLM understands the question or task at hand. This reduces the chances of misinterpretation.
  • Specificity: Specific prompts provide detailed context and instructions, making it easier for the model to generate accurate and relevant responses.

When balancing clarity and specificity, it’s important to consider the needs of the task and the target audience. Too much specificity can restrict the model’s ability to provide comprehensive answers, while too little can lead to vague or irrelevant outputs. For more insights on how wording impacts AI responses, visit our article on ai prompt responses.

Elements of a Well-Crafted Prompt

A well-crafted prompt typically includes several key elements that provide necessary context and guidance for the LLM. These elements help to streamline the response and increase accuracy, thereby saving time and improving efficiency (DigitalOcean).

Element Description Example
Context/Background Provides necessary background information or context for the task. “In the field of renewable energy…”
Instructions Directs the AI on what action to take. “Summarize the main points of this article.”
Input Data Specifies the data or information the AI will use. “Using the data from the annual sales report…”
Output Indicators Describes the desired format or type of response. “Provide a 200-word summary.”

Including examples in prompts can also guide the responses in the desired direction, ensuring accurate and tailored outputs for complex tasks with more than one correct answer.

  • Context/Background: Sets the stage for the prompt by providing relevant information that the model needs to know.
  • Instructions: Clearly states the task that the model should perform.
  • Input Data: Specifies the exact data or parameters the model should consider.
  • Output Indicators: Defines how the response should be formatted or what should be included.

Effective prompt crafting is an essential skill for ai prompt management, playing a crucial role in improving accuracy, saving time, facilitating complex tasks, enhancing user experience, enabling better outcomes, and driving innovation (DigitalOcean).

To explore more about prompt management, check out our articles on ai prompt tracking, prompt management tools, and ai prompt enhancement.

Implementing Prompt Management Practices

In mastering prompt management for production-level large language models (LLMs), it’s essential to implement effective operational techniques. Two vital practices include setting up version control and fostering collaboration, as well as decoupling prompts from core code.

Version Control and Collaboration

Effective version control and collaboration systems are foundational to reliable prompt management. These systems ensure that prompts can be updated, reviewed, and traced efficiently across development cycles. According to QWAK, prompt management tools are designed to solve practical deployment issues by providing features such as:

  • Version Control: Keeping a history of all prompt iterations, aiding in tracking changes and reverting to earlier versions if needed.
  • Collaboration: Allowing multiple stakeholders to work on prompt development simultaneously, ensuring a smooth flow of ideas and updates.

Collaborative environments and version control systems are instrumental in maintaining organized workflows and preventing disruptions during prompt testing. These tools also enable seamless integration with development pipelines, ensuring that the prompt management process aligns with the overall project goals.

Feature Benefits
Version Control Tracks changes and maintains history
Collaboration Supports team efforts and innovation
Access Control Regulates user permissions
Integration Compatible with existing workflows
Traceability Monitors prompt performance

Decoupling from Core Code

Decoupling prompts from the core codebase is a significant practice in prompt management, promoting flexibility and minimizing potential disruptions (QWAK). By separating prompts from the main code, developers can manage and update prompts without altering the core application. This practice allows for:

  • Ease of Updates: Prompts can be refined and enhanced independently, allowing for rapid iterations and prompt enhancement without needing full-scale application redeployments.
  • Effective Prompt Testing: Changes can be tested in isolated environments, ensuring new versions do not interfere with application stability.

Decoupling also supports ai prompt exploration, facilitating experimentation with different prompt structures and phrasings.

Benefit Description
Ease of Updates Prompts can be updated independently of the main codebase
Prompt Testing Enables isolated environments for safe testing and validation
Application Stability Maintains core application integrity during prompt refinements
Experimentation Supports iterative prompt development and optimization

These implementing practices of version control, collaboration, and decoupling are crucial components of effective prompt management. They collectively contribute to the stability, flexibility, and continuous improvement of prompt-based AI systems.

Maximizing Prompt Effectiveness

In the realm of AI prompt management, maximizing the effectiveness of prompts is central to achieving desired outcomes. This section highlights two crucial aspects: strategic prompt engineering and the impact of prompt specificity.

Strategic Prompt Engineering

Prompt engineering is a technique used to optimize the interaction between users and large language models (LLMs). It involves crafting specific, well-structured prompts to guide the AI in generating accurate and relevant responses. Prompt engineering requires a combination of logic, coding, and artistry, and it significantly influences the quality of the output (TechTarget).

Key strategies in prompt engineering include:

  • Experimentation: Testing different phrasings of instructions or questions to gauge how they impact responses.
  • Refinement: Continuously tweaking prompts based on feedback and observed performance.
  • Customization: Tailoring prompts to the specific domain or context in which the AI is being deployed.

By implementing these strategies, organizations can improve model behavior, enhance output quality, and ensure more precise and effective AI interactions.

Impact of Prompt Specificity

The specificity of a prompt plays a critical role in the accuracy and relevance of the AI’s responses. Well-crafted prompts lead to more precise answers, minimizing the chances of misinterpretation and irrelevant outcomes (DigitalOcean).

Consider the following aspects when crafting specific prompts:

  • Clarity: Ensure the prompt is clear and unambiguous.
  • Context: Include sufficient context to guide the AI’s response appropriately.
  • Detail: Provide detailed instructions to limit the scope for misinterpretation.

The table below illustrates how prompt specificity can impact AI responses:

Prompt Type Example Prompt Likely Response Quality
General “Tell me about the weather.” Low (Vague, broad information)
Specific “Tell me about the weather in New York City on March 10th, 2023.” High (Detailed, relevant information)

By focusing on specificity, users can enhance the accuracy and relevance of AI-generated responses. For more on tailoring prompts, visit our guide on ai prompt customization.

These techniques are vital for professionals looking to optimize their use of AI in various applications. Understanding the nuances of prompt engineering and the importance of specificity can lead to the development of robust prompt-based AI applications that deliver consistent and valuable outputs. For further reading on prompt crafting, see our section on ai prompt generation.

Evaluating and Refining Prompts

Effective prompt management techniques are essential for optimizing the use of large language models (LLMs). Two key components in this process are monitoring usage and costs, and tracking and evaluating performance.

Monitoring Usage and Costs

Keeping track of usage and costs is vital in prompt management, particularly when using third-party LLM providers that charge based on the number of tokens processed. Longer prompts and verbose outputs can quickly escalate costs, making it crucial to monitor and manage usage to stay within budget (Qwak).

Prompt Type Token Count Cost per 1,000 Tokens ($) Monthly Cost ($)
Short Prompt 50 0.02 100
Medium Prompt 150 0.02 300
Long Prompt 250 0.02 500

Costs can vary depending on the provider and specific terms of service. It is important to regularly review these costs to avoid unexpected expenses. For more detailed information on keeping track of prompt usage, visit our AI prompt tracking page.

Performance Tracking and Evaluation

Evaluating the effectiveness of prompts on a regular basis ensures that they meet the desired outcomes and adapt to the capabilities of different LLM models. A comprehensive tracking system is essential for in-depth analysis of prompt performance across various scenarios, aiding in the continual refinement of prompts (Qwak).

Metric Description Target Value
Prompt Response Accuracy The percentage of correct responses generated by the prompt 95%
Token Efficiency The ratio of relevant tokens to total tokens processed 80%
Response Time Average time taken to generate a response < 2 seconds

Maintaining a change log, decoupling prompts from application code, modularizing prompts, and setting up performance benchmarks are best practices for managing LLM prompts effectively. These practices not only optimize interactions with LLMs but also ensure that prompts align well with the model’s abilities and the application’s needs (DigitalOcean).

For further reading on how to evaluate and refine prompts, including details on monitoring tools and methodologies, visit our AI prompt validation page.

Tools for Prompt Management

Effective management of prompts is essential for leveraging the power of Language Learning Models (LLMs). Various tools offer specialized features to streamline this process. In this section, we will explore two prominent tools: Langchain and Humanloop, along with Langfuse, a robust open-source platform.

Langchain and Humanloop

Langchain and Humanloop specialize in the domain of prompt management for LLM applications. These tools provide comprehensive features such as version control, collaboration, access control, integration, traceability, and prompt evaluation, ensuring optimal usage and deployment of prompts (Qwak).

Humanloop

Humanloop is designed to enhance the collaborative efforts of teams working on LLM applications. This platform offers various features aimed at simplifying the prompt management process, including:

  • Prompt Creation: Facilitates the development and fine-tuning of prompts.
  • Model Deployment: Simplifies the integration and implementation of models.
  • A/B Testing: Enables testing different prompts to determine the most effective ones.
  • Tools Integration: Connects with various tools for seamless workflow.
  • Dataset Collection: Collects relevant data to improve prompt and model performance.
  • Prompt and Model Evaluation: Provides detailed assessment to ensure high efficiency.
Feature Description
Prompt Creation Development and fine-tuning of prompts.
Model Deployment Simplifies the integration of models.
A/B Testing Tests different prompts for effectiveness.
Tools Integration Seamless workflow with various tools.
Dataset Collection Improves performance through data collection.
Prompt Evaluation Detailed assessment for high efficiency.

By incorporating these features, Humanloop supports independent testing, deployment, and a comprehensive evaluation of interactions (Qwak). For more detailed insights, refer to our section on ai prompt collaboration.

Langfuse Features and Benefits

Langfuse is an open-source platform that offers robust prompt management capabilities. The platform provides essential features that include:

  • Logging and Versioning: Tracks the history and changes of prompts.
  • Tagging and Labeling: Organizes prompts for easy identification and retrieval.
  • Prompt Playground: Facilitates real-time testing of prompts.
  • Request Tracing: Offers detailed traceability of prompt requests.
  • Data Utilization: Monitors metrics related to LLM usage and costs.
  • Dashboard Displays: Visualizes results for easy interpretation and analysis.
Feature Description
Logging Tracks the history and changes of prompts.
Versioning Manages different versions of prompts.
Tagging Organizes prompts for easy identification.
Prompt Playground Real-time testing of prompts.
Request Tracing Detailed traceability of prompt requests.
Data Utilization Monitors LLM usage and costs.
Dashboard Visualizes results for easy analysis.

Langfuse addresses practical challenges in deploying LLMs by providing features for version control, collaboration, access control, integration, traceability, and evaluation (Qwak). These tools ensure only the most effective prompts are in use and facilitate a seamless workflow for LLM applications. For additional tools that assist in prompt management, explore prompt management tools.

By leveraging tools like Humanloop and Langfuse, professionals can streamline their prompt management processes, ensuring efficient and effective deployment in LLM applications.

Challenges in Prompt Engineering

Prompt engineering involves overcoming several obstacles to ensure effective AI interactions. Two major challenges in this field are balancing clarity and specificity, and mitigating biases in prompts.

Balancing Clarity and Specificity

Achieving the right balance between clarity and specificity is essential in prompt engineering. If a prompt is too vague, it can lead to ambiguous or irrelevant responses from the AI. Conversely, overly specific prompts can constrain the AI, reducing its ability to generate flexible and creative outputs. Professionals must aim to provide sufficient information for the AI to understand the task without restricting its natural language generation capabilities.

Example Table: Clarity vs. Specificity in Prompts

Prompt Type Example Prompt Potential Issue
Too Vague “Describe a book.” Ambiguous response
Balanced “Describe the plot of ‘To Kill a Mockingbird’.” Effective balance
Too Specific “Provide a 150-word summary of the main plot points and character development in chapters 1-3 of ‘To Kill a Mockingbird’.” Limits flexibility

Effective prompt crafting leverages a balanced approach, providing clear instructions with room for the AI to interpret and generate diverse responses. Explore more prompt management techniques for effective prompt crafting.

Mitigating Biases in Prompts

Another significant challenge is ensuring that prompts are free from biases. Biased prompts can lead to unfair or discriminatory AI outputs, which can have adverse effects in professional and social settings. Ensuring fairness and impartiality in prompts requires careful evaluation and refinement of the language used.

Prompts can inadvertently carry biases related to gender, race, and socioeconomic status. Mitigating these biases involves continuous monitoring of AI outputs and refining prompts to promote neutrality. Biased prompts can skew AI responses, resulting in outputs that perpetuate stereotypes or unintentional discrimination (LinkedIn).

Example Table: Identifying and Mitigating Biases in Prompts

Prompt Type Example Prompt Potential Bias Mitigated Prompt
Biased “Describe the achievements of famous male scientists.” Gender bias “Describe the achievements of famous scientists.”
Neutral “Explain the impact of socioeconomic background on education.” Bias inclusive of all backgrounds “Explain various factors impacting education.”

Professionals must regularly review and revise prompts to maintain fair and unbiased AI interactions. Learn more about ensuring ai prompt compliance and other best practices.

By addressing these challenges, prompt engineers can enhance the quality and efficacy of AI systems, ensuring reliable and equitable responses across diverse applications.

The Role of Prompt Engineering

Prompt engineering is pivotal in the field of artificial intelligence. It involves designing and refining prompts to yield accurate and relevant AI responses. Mastering prompt management techniques is key for professionals seeking to maximize the effectiveness of AI applications.

Expertise in Specific Fields

A crucial aspect of prompt engineering is domain expertise. Understanding the area in which the AI operates is essential. Engineers must possess a comprehensive knowledge of the specific field to craft prompts that align precisely with the context and requirements. Expertise ensures that the prompts are well-structured, clear, and contextually appropriate, leading to accurate and meaningful AI responses.

For example, crafting prompts for a medical diagnostic AI requires a deep understanding of medical terminology and procedures. This expertise enables the prompt engineer to structure questions that guide the AI in delivering precise and useful information. Similarly, when designing prompts for a legal AI application, engineers must be well-versed in legal language and concepts to ensure relevance and accuracy (LinkedIn).

Continuous Improvement in Prompt Quality

Continuous improvement is vital in prompt engineering. The effectiveness of prompts must be regularly evaluated and refined to keep pace with advancements in AI technology and changes in user needs. This iterative process involves monitoring AI responses, analyzing their accuracy, and making necessary adjustments to the prompts.

Regularly incorporating user feedback is a valuable strategy for refining prompts. Users can provide insights into the clarity and effectiveness of the prompts, highlighting areas for enhancement. By leveraging this feedback, prompt engineers can make informed modifications to improve prompt quality and AI performance.

Performance tracking is another critical aspect of continuous improvement. Engineers must monitor how prompts impact AI responses, usage, and costs. Tracking metrics such as accuracy, response time, and user satisfaction can identify areas where prompts need adjustment. For more information on tracking techniques, visit our article on ai prompt tracking.

Incorporating data into prompts is another technique to enhance quality. Data-driven prompts provide a foundation for detailed analysis and decision-making, improving the relevance and accuracy of AI-generated responses (DigitalOcean).

Metric Importance Strategy for Improvement
Accuracy High Regular evaluation and refinement
Response Time Medium Optimize prompt structure
User Satisfaction High Incorporate user feedback

Effective prompt engineering also involves addressing challenges such as balancing clarity and specificity and mitigating biases. Ensuring prompts are clear yet flexible enough to allow creative AI thinking is crucial. Engineers must also thoroughly check prompts for fairness to avoid biases in AI responses (LinkedIn).

By focusing on domain expertise and continuous improvement, professionals can master prompt management techniques, ensuring AI systems deliver accurate, relevant, and unbiased responses. For more insights on prompt engineering strategies, check out our articles on ai prompt generation and ai prompt adaptation.

Discover how PromptPanda can streamline your prompt management now!

Never lose a prompt again

Ready to streamline your team's AI Prompt workflow?